Trading Technologies Launches Connectivity to NSE IFSC-SGX Connect for International Nifty Equity Derivatives Trading

Trading Technologies International, Inc. (TT), the global provider of trading software, infrastructure and data solutions has begun offering clients access to the popular Nifty equity derivatives through NSE IFSC-SGX Connect, a new joint initiative between Singapore Exchange and National Stock Exchange of India launched on July 29.

As one of the first technology providers to offer international market participants access to the NSE IFSC-SGX Connect, TT is giving global banks and other major financial institutions that use the TT® platform seamless access to Nifty equity derivatives alongside products from more than 50 other major international markets, including SGX Group.
